Job Description

Description
Amazon is on mission to reinvent pharmacy and drive the future of online purchase of pharmacy products.
You will work on a team where you can make an impact every day, at every level.
The growth of the business and the complex customer problems make this role an exciting and interesting proposition.
Expect to get involved in high visibility, high impact new projects and initiatives, drive customer experience for the category, and help build plans for the future, in addition to exposure to senior stakeholders across product, engineering, business, operations.
Amazon Pharmacy is looking for an experienced product manager with expertise and passion to imagine, build and manage an innovative product.
You will have full ownership and responsibility through the full product lifecycle from customer feedback and research, product strategy, requirements development, roadmap prioritization, development, measurement of adoption, metrics and iteration.
This role will require strong leadership skills and interaction/influence with teams across Amazon to drive the development of our product.
The ideal candidate will be curious, have strong attention to detail, be motivated/energized by a fast
- paced entrepreneurial environment, be comfortable thinking big while also diving deep, will have high judgement and comfort managing senior stakeholders.
Key job responsibilities
Responsibilities include:
• Set product strategy and vision
• Define product requirements; Write product development briefs to outline requirements
• Work with development teams to deliver product to the market
• Manage prioritization and trade
- offs among customer experience, performance and operational support load
• Partner closely with Business Leader, Customer Service, Operational, Legal, Compliance and Finance teams to ensure alignment with product goals
• Proactively identify and resolve strategic issues that may impair the team’s ability to meet strategic, financial, and technical goals
• Work to constantly improve our product; Continually improve the customer experience throughout the entire customer journey

Basic Qualifications
- 7+ years of product or program management, product marketing, business development or technology experience
- Master's degree or equivalent
- Experience owning/driving roadmap strategy and definition
- Experience with end to end product delivery
- Experience with feature delivery and tradeoffs of a product
- Experience as a product manager or owner
- Experience owning technology products
- Knowledge of key customer experience metrics and methodology (e.g., NPS)

Preferred Qualifications
- Experience in influencing senior leadership through data driven insights
- Experience working across functional teams and senior stakeholders

About Company

Amazon is a multinational technology and e-commerce company founded by Jeff Bezos in 1994. Initially focused on selling books online, it quickly expanded into a broad range of products and services, including electronics, cloud computing (via Amazon Web Services), streaming, and artificial intelligence. Amazon has revolutionized online shopping with fast delivery, personalized recommendations, and a subscription service called Amazon Prime. It is one of the world's largest and most valuable companies, with a significant impact on retail, technology, and logistics.
